The ignition lock cylinder in a car is the part that mechanically controls that allows the key to be in to start the car. The pins in the cylinder move up and down, allowing the key to move in and out. Also, it has wafer tumblers to keep the pins in place. Over time the tumblers can wear out or even break and stop the key from turning. Eventually, the cylinder can fail completely, causing dead batteries and other issues with the car's start.

The most popular type is the cylinder lock. The outer shell features a cylindrical hole which houses the plug. The outer shell of a cylinder lock is generally constructed of steel. The plug is usually bronze or brass. Cylinder locks have different pins that allow them to be locked or unlocked in a variety of ways. Some have extra security measures such as snap lines or additional pins to guard against bumping into locks and other kinds of lock picking.

Although it is possible to repair a difficult lock cylinder using graphite or WD-40 these methods aren't likely to work for long. It is better to replace the ignition lock cylinder. You can do this by removing the old cylinder for your ignition lock from your vehicle and replacing it with a brand new one. New keys are required to replace the cylinder.

Standard systems usually cost less than $300 to replace the ignition lock cylinder. Certain vehicles come with electronic locks that are more expensive to replace. It is important that the process of replacing the ignition cylinder is done by an accredited professional. This is due to removal of components that could interfere with the supplemental restraint system (airbags).

It is necessary to disconnect the negative battery cables before replacing the battery. This is required to prevent an airbag from being accidentally deployed. Also, you should remove the airbag system in the event that it has one. Follow all instructions from the factory. You'll need to reset the anti-theft codes following installation of the new ignition lock. This will prevent your vehicle from being taken and could require the use of a specific tool.

Ignition Interlock Devices

A breathalyzer is an ignition interlock device that must be installed in your vehicle to satisfy the law or a criminal obligation. Ignition interlocks detect alcohol use disorders in drivers by analyzing their breath prior to when the engine of the vehicle is started. If the IID determines that the driver's alcohol consumption is greater than the limit allowed the alarm will sound, and/or the lights will flash to indicate that the vehicle can be stopped and the driver can take a second test.

Ignition interlocks are a great device for people suffering from drinking disorders because they require that the user blow into a mouthpiece prior to starting the vehicle. They are small and subtle which means they can be easily hidden away from the view of others to avoid attracting attention. The cost of ignition interlocks is $60-90 per month.
